Are the Boltons loyal to the Starks?
A thousand years prior to the events of the War of the Five Kings, the Boltons swore fealty and pledged their support to House Stark. Seven hundred years later the Boltons rebelled, breaking their oaths of loyalty. Eventually, after a four year siege of the Dreadfort, the Boltons became loyal vassals once again.

Did the Boltons hate the Starks?
Since the Long Night the Red Kings were bitter rivals of the Kings of Winter, the Starks of Winterfell. The Boltons achieved some successes against the Starks, with Kings Royce II and Royce IV burning Winterfell. The Boltons are said to have flayed the skins of several Stark lords and hung them in the Dreadfort.

Are all the Boltons dead?
House Bolton is most likely extinct, as the only known members of the family were Roose and Ramsay. Roose, his wife Walda (formerly) Frey, and their infant son were all killed by Ramsay, who was then killed by the Starks.
